Not only Amazon. Do the same on office supply stores. We buy a lot of presentation folders. Often one color, which is only visible on the binding side and the very back, will have a lower price than other colors and it can change each time. Another pattern I've seen is that when some electronics are new colors often aimed at girls and women ( usually shades of pink or or rose) will be more expensive but when the overall item goes on sale, these colors will drop down the most.

fallingupthehill

Youth sneakers can be up to 30% cheaper than womens sneakers. Same brand. Example I wear a 6.5/7 and buy Youth sizes 5/,5.5 sizes. I usually stick with New Balance , but most big brands can be checked. I haven't paid more thsn 50 dollars for a good pair of sneakers. If you're not sure what will fit you, try a pair of Youth sized ones next time you shop. I tend to buy the boys styles for more durability, but have been known to get girls too.
